The 1961 Parker Brothers Monopoly No. 9 is a quintessential piece of mid-century Americana, marking a significant era in the game's branding evolution. This specific edition is highly collectible for its transition to the modern graphic style, most notably the introduction of the distinctive teal swirl logo on the white box.
What Is Parker Brothers Monopoly No. 9 Worth?
The typical price range for Parker Brothers Monopoly No. 9 is $35 - $38 based on recent sales. However, values can vary depending on the item's condition, rarity, and other factors such as:
- Completeness of the set, including all original metal tokens, wooden buildings, and the full deck of Chance and Community Chest cards.
- The structural integrity of the white box, as these are prone to corner splits and shelf wear that can lower the $35-$38 valuation.
- The crispness and color preservation of the teal swirl logo and the game board's playing surface.
- Presence of the original 1961 instruction manual and any era-specific promotional inserts.
How to Identify Parker Brothers Monopoly No. 9?
- Look for the specific 'No. 9' designation printed on the side of the white rectangular box.
- Verify the presence of the 1961 copyright date and the teal/blue swirl Parker Brothers logo.
- Check for a mix of materials including wooden houses and hotels alongside metal tokens and cardboard property cards.
- Confirm the box features the classic 'Rich Uncle Pennybags' illustration centered within the mid-century branding.
History of Parker Brothers Monopoly No. 9
Originally popularized during the Great Depression, Monopoly became a cultural phenomenon. This 1961 version was produced during the era of Parker Brothers' transition to modern graphic branding, specifically featuring the blue swirl logo that became a staple of mid-century American gaming.
